Barcelona loanee Julian Araujo has been substituted during the La Liga encounter between UD Las Palmas and Celta Vigo today at Gran Canaria with a possible injury.

Araujo left Barça to join Las Palmas on a season-long loan deal during the summer transfer window in search of game-time.

Having joined the Blaugrana in January earlier this year, the 22-year-old spent the second half of the last season without any competitive football as the transfer had not been ratified by FIFA due to delays in paperwork.

While everything was resolved in the summer, he was never going to get many minutes at Barcelona and as such it was decided that Araujo would be joining Las Palmas on loan.

Having moved to the newly-promoted La Liga club, the Mexican right-back has been getting regular minutes up until this point.

Indeed, tonight’s game against Celta Vigo was Araujo’s sixth start for Las Palmas in their eighth game of the season.

However, it ended on a disappointing note for the Barcelona loanee as he had to be taken off at the half-hour mark after he appeared to have picked up an injury.

The Mexican international was replaced by Alvaro Lemos and a clearer update on his condition should emerge in the coming days.

Las Palmas and Barcelona will both be hoping that it is nothing serious as it is crucial for Araujo to keep playing regularly to gain experience in European football.
